James Robert Dale

Published 7:58 am Friday, March 20, 2020

James Robert Dale “Litleon”, 77, passed away Monday, Feb. 24, 2020.
Services were held Friday, Feb. 28, 2020, at 11 a.m. at Prentiss
Baptist Church, followed by burial at Whitesand Cemetery.
Pallbearers were Chad Stokes, Micheal Gunter, Doug Dale, Derek Dale,
Matthew Berry, William Hathorn, Karon Bridges and Wayne Bass.
Honorary palbearers were Parker Dale, Lenix Dale and James Dale’s
Sunday School class at Prentiss Baptist Church.
Mr. Dale was a member of Prentiss Baptist Church. He worked as a law
enforcement officer for the Mississippi Department of Transportation
for 31 years. He also spent over 20 years volunteering for Jefferson
Davis County youth sports. He enjoyed cooking, woodworking and was an
avid fox hunter. He loved gardening, mainly for the sole purpose of
giving his produce to friends. Above all things, he loved his family,
most of all his grand kids.
He was preceded in death by his parents, Cowsart and Daisy Dale.
He is survived by his wife of 52 years, Wondra Dale of Prentiss; two
sons, James Corey (Marianne) Dale of Brandon and Robert Casey
(Kristen) Dale of Sumrall; one daughter, Kameron Dale of Hattiesburg;
four grandchildren, Aubrey Dale, Lainey Dale, Parker Dale and Lenix
Dale; and one brother, George (Yvette) Dale of Clinton.
Visitation was Thursday, Feb. 27, 2020, from 5 p.m. until 8 p.m. at
Prentiss Baptist Church.
Memorials may be made to the Haley Rose Gunter Scholarship Fund at
Mississippi College, Box 4005, Clinton, MS 39058, or to Prentiss
Baptist Church.
